Kid
Witness News
(KWN) is a hands-on
video education program created to encourage students to develop
valuable cognitive, communication and organizational skills through the
use of video. This unique program provides schools with an array of
video equipment and offers participants the opportunity to develop their
interests, abilities and creativity through the production of videos.
Kid Witness News was developed and is supported by Panasonic in
conjunction with the public school system in more than 200 participating
schools. Under teacher supervision, students research, write, act in,
produce, direct and edit a variety of videos which bring to life
subjects they are learning about in school and in their everyday
experiences. The students' videos feature current events, news reports,
public service announcements and interviews with prominent individuals,
as well as many other topics which are relevant to today's youth. Their
creative works are then submitted for review in the annual "New Vision"
awards video contest. |
